About 6 Chipperfield Road
6 Chipperfield Road is a three-bedroom semi-detached house in Birmingham (B36 8BJ). It has a recorded floor area of 76 m² (around 816 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1930-1949 and council tax band B. The latest certificate (July 2011) shows a D (score 63), on the cusp of jumping into the C band. The latest certificate is from July 2011, so improvements made since then won't be reflected.
Today's modelled estimate of £189,000 sits 94.8% above the 2011 sale of £97,000. Last changed hands 15 years ago, in December 2011.
